Current Innovations in Meat Fermentation with a View to Producing More Sustainable, Healthier and Safer Products
Ciarán H Crowley1, Geraldine Duffy2, Artur Gluchowski3
1School of Food and Nutritional Sciences, University College Cork, T12 E138 Cork, Ireland.
Abstract:
Fermentation is a longstanding preservation process used in meat manufacture to improve product stability, safety and sensory quality. Renewed interest in fermented meats has stimulated research into reformulation and processing strategies intended to address concerns associated with salt, nitrate, nitrite, smoke-derived contaminants and animal fat while maintaining effective fermentation and product quality. This narrative review critically examines current innovations in fermented meat manufacture, including the replacement or reduction of conventional preservatives, smoking alternatives, fat reformulation, functional starter cultures, probiotics, prebiotics and bacteriocins. Developments in non-thermal and accelerated processing, edible and active packaging, intelligent monitoring systems and emerging culture-development technologies are also considered. Evidence indicates that selected functional cultures and formulation strategies can support preservative reduction, microbial control, curing, oxidative stability and sensory development, although their effectiveness is strain-, product- and process-dependent. Several processing and packaging technologies offer additional possibilities for improving manufacturing efficiency, shelf-life management and product safety, but their validation in fermented meat systems varies considerably. Potential environmental benefits, including reduced refrigeration, shorter processing or extended shelf life, cannot be assumed to confer lower overall environmental impacts and require comparative assessment of energy use, material inputs, food-waste effects and life-cycle performance. Future development should therefore prioritise product-specific validation, integrated hurdle-system assessment, regulatory compliance, consumer acceptance and comparative environmental evaluation.
